Disclaimers
* For the purposes of the incentives described in this document, Business Partner incentives are available to design engineers, engineering consultants, HVAC contractors and third-party contractors in Enbridge Gas’ service area (Ontario only). The complete list of eligible equipment and customer incentives is outlined in the Enbridge Gas 2025 commercial energy efficiency programs brochures and on our website.
Incentives are only made available to customers where Enbridge Gas energy efficiency offer(s) have impacted the customer’s decision to proceed with the improvement(s). The customer must be the owner of the applicable energy-efficient equipment and have an active Enbridge Gas account in good standing. Incentive offers are available between Jan. 1, 2025 and Dec. 31, 2025 (natural gas equipment must be installed by Dec. 31, 2025). Eligible market-rate multi-residential buildings will need to demonstrate either at least 30 percent of units are rented at less than 80 percent of the median market rent, determined by the Canadian Mortgage and Housing Corporation, based on the information gathered during rent roll review by Enbridge Gas, or the building has participated in a federal, provincial, or municipal affordable housing funding program in the last five years.
The maximum Business Partner incentive covered with the fixed incentive program is $1,000/project for all qualified energy-efficient equipment, except for multi-unit residential in-suite projects incentives at five percent of the total customer incentive per building. Multi-unit residential incentives apply to buildings exceeding 600 m2 in building area or exceeding three storeys in building height and used for major occupancies classified as residential occupancies; these incentives are not applicable to affordable housing multi-residential buildings. As described in Division A of the Ontario Building Code (per section 1.1.2.2. Application of part 3, 4, 5 and 6). Multi-unit residential in-suite incentives for customers are capped at a maximum of $50,000 for ERV projects and $25,000 for HRV projects. See full details on our website.
To receive any incentive, a completed 2025 commercial and industrial or affordable housing multi-residential energy efficiency fixed incentive application form, proof of purchase matched to the installation address and one of the following documents must be provided to Enbridge Gas: (i) project quote that shows Enbridge Gas incentive, (ii) technical input sheet (TIS) or (iii) customer/business partner email acknowledgement of Enbridge Gas incentive. All commercial and industrial incentives are paid on a per-unit basis unless otherwise indicated. The Business Partner One-Time Bonus Offer is awarded and paid out once at year-end based on the total number of qualified units installed between Jan. 1, 2025 and Dec. 31, 2025 (inclusive). Qualified units are measures that are approved for customer incentives through the fixed (prescriptive) incentive program. Multi-unit residential in-suite projects, custom projects, and affordable housing multi-residential project are excluded from the One-Time Bonus Offer, under fixed incentive program. Under affordable-housing multi-residential incentive program, multi-unit residential in-suite projects and custom projects are excluded from the One-Time Bonus Offer.
Allow 4 to 6 weeks for delivery of payment.
